On Tuesday evening there was an exciting duel in the Regionalliga Nordost in Leipzig, in which BSG Chemie Leipzig had to play against FC Rot-Weiß Erfurt. The game was charged from the start and ended with a narrow 0-1 for the guests. A game that will remain in the minds of viewers for various reasons.
The game started very badly for the hosts. Already in the 2nd minute, Julian Weigel saw the red card after a foul on Erfurt's Stanislav. Due to being outnumbered early on, Erfurt immediately developed pressure, but were only able to create a few half-chances. Their best opportunity came from Philip Aboagye in the 23rd minute, whose shot was deflected towards a corner by goalkeeper Florian Horenburg. Chemie Leipzig, on the other hand, had some top-class players in the first half, especially between the 36th and 38th minutes.

The game was characterized by many duels, two dismissals and a total of eight yellow cards, which underlined the fighting spirit of both teams. The next decisive turn came in the 50th minute: Aboagye received a yellow-red card for repeated foul play, so that both teams had to deal with ten players. Despite more possession, Erfurt was able to take control of the game and finally score the decisive goal in the 48th minute through Marco Wolf.
Coach Adrian Alipour spoke about the difficulties in preparing for the game, particularly due to suspensions that put his team in distress. Valon Aliji, who was suspended for a short time, asked the audience for their understanding and was visibly disappointed with the decision.

With this win, Erfurt climbs to first place in the table, at least until Wednesday. Chemie Leipzig, which was sweating badly due to the suspensions and sending offs, was unable to equalize despite attempts in the constant rain. The sports management and the team announced a protest against Aliji's suspension. With 4,999 spectators, the atmosphere in the stadium was tense, but the fans stood by their team.
